What is a Robo Mop?

A Robo Mop is an automatic floor-cleaning gadget developed to mop tough surfaces in your house. These robotics have sensing units and smart shows that allow them to browse around furniture and obstacles while cleaning up floors. Geared up with numerous cleaning modes, they provide a mix of mopping, sweeping, and in some cases vacuuming in a single system.

Advantages of Using a Robo Mop

1. Time-Saving

One of the most significant advantages of a Robo Mop is the time it conserves homeowners. With a hectic lifestyle, discovering the time to frequently clean floors can be difficult. Robo Mops take this concern off your shoulders, allowing you to spend your time on more satisfying activities.

2. Constant Cleaning

Robo Mops are configured for repetitive cleansing. Unlike humans, who may overlook an area, these devices supply consistent cleaning outcomes, making sure that your floorings remain clean gradually.

3. Ease of access

Robo Mops can quickly navigate tight spaces and under furniture, locations that are often overlooked throughout standard cleaning. This accessibility makes sure an extensive cleansing that can enhance the look of your floorings.

4. Eco-Friendly Options

Numerous Robo Mops offer environmentally friendly cleansing services. They often use minimal water and can clean up with just a microfiber fabric, reducing the quantity of cleaning chemicals required while still achieving a high standard of cleanliness.

5. Technology Integration

The most advanced Robo Mops can be incorporated with clever home systems, permitting remote cleansing schedules and real-time monitoring of cleansing development. This benefit element makes them appealing to tech-savvy property owners.

6. Decreased Physical Exertion

For those with movement concerns or physical constraints, a Robo Mop can significantly decrease the physical stress associated with traditional mopping. It offers an independent cleansing service that doesn't need bending or heavy lifting.

Drawbacks of Using a Robo Mop

1. Initial Cost

Robo Mops can be more expensive in advance compared to standard mops. Nevertheless, many property owners discover the benefit and time cost savings to be worth the investment.

2. Maintenance Requirements

While Robo Mops are developed to simplify cleaning, they do need routine maintenance. This includes cleaning the sensors, changing damaged parts, and guaranteeing the water reservoir is filled. Ignoring upkeep can minimize their efficiency.

3. Limited Cleaning Power

Robo Mops may not be as powerful as manual mopping or standard vacuuming. For sturdy cleansing jobs or sticky stains, a traditional approach might still be needed.

4. Battery Life and Range

Some Robo Mops may battle with battery life, limiting the area they can cover before requiring a recharge. Comprehending the system's battery efficiency is important for efficient use.

5. Learning Curve

Comprehending how to operate and configure a Robo Mop can come with a learning curve, specifically for individuals who are not particularly tech-savvy.

Key Features to Consider

When examining different Robo Mops, a number of crucial functions should be taken into consideration:

FeatureDescription
Cleaning ModesVarious modes might include dry sweeping, wet mopping, or deep cleansing.
Water ReservoirThe size of the water tank influences the length of time the mop can run before requiring a refill.
Navigation TechnologyFeatures such as LIDAR mapping, infrared sensing units, and gyroscope performance boost navigation capabilities.
Battery LifeThe duration the Robo Mop can run before needing a recharge.
Noise LevelThink about if noise level is an issue-- some models are quieter than others.
Filter TypeHEPA filters can assist improve indoor air quality, especially for allergic reaction victims.
